摘要
We have measured simultaneously thermally stimulated current (TSC) and thermoluminescence (TL) of polyethylene terephthalate (PET) film. There are one broad peak in the temperature range of 150-250K on both TL and TSC curves, the peak temperature (T-m) on TL curve is about 194K, and the T-m on TSC one is about 208K. In the temperature range of 255-320K, TSC curve gives another broad peak We analyze the curves by using our auto-resolving method and obtain a set of peaks. In the temperature range of 150-250K the activation energies of TL and TSC processes vary from 0.25eV to 0.46eV and 0.24eV to 0.44ev respectively. For the other peak of TSC, the responding activation energies change from 0.45eV to 0.53eV. The initial carrier concentration in the traps both obey approximate Gauss distribution for the lower temperature peaks on TL and TSC curves, the peaks are ascribed to the motion of-COO group.
